About Jubilee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Jubilee Court is a semi-detached house in Hounslow (TW3 1UP). It has a recorded floor area of 55 m² (around 592 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. The latest certificate (March 2022)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(July 2009);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, main heating went from Poor to Average;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or and hot-water ef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). Main heating runs on electricity. At 55 m² this is the 12th smallest of 19 units on EPC record in Jubilee Court, where floor areas span 43–71 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 19 units on file.

Untraded for 24 years, with the last transfer in April 2002. Across 1999–2002, sale prices on this property compounded at 15.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£290,000 sits 144.7% above the 2002 sale of £118,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£200/sq ft) was about 18.7% below the postcode norm.
